As things stand now, Tulane is ranked 24th in the College Football Playoff rankings, the highest ranking for a G5 school this season. The Green Wave will be the current representative in the CFP coming out of the Power Four.
Sumrall is 18-7 at Tulane after going 23-4 at Troy in 2022 and ’23. With an overall record of 41-11, Sumrall is one of the hottest names on the coaching carousel.
Interestingly, Sumrall has SEC experience. he coached kentucky as a GA (2005-06), at Ole Miss as linebackers coach (2018) and at Kentucky as inside linebackers coach and co-defensive coordinator (2019-21).
